What does ICD-10 code S61.302A mean?

ICD-10-CM code S61.302A represents “Unspecified open wound of right middle finger with damage to nail, initial encounter”. It is classified under Chapter 19: Injury, Poisoning and Certain Other Consequences of External Causes and is a billable/specific code that can be used on a claim.

What chapter is S61.302A in?

S61.302A is in Chapter 19: Injury, Poisoning and Certain Other Consequences of External Causes (codes S00-T88).

What are the UMLS CUIs for S61.302A?

S61.302A is linked to 1 UMLS Concept Unique Identifier: C2850062. The UMLS (Unified Medical Language System) integrates multiple biomedical vocabularies maintained by the U.S. National Library of Medicine.
